Viewing Your AWS Identifiers

Your Access Key ID and Secret Access Key are displayed to you when you create your AWS account. They are not e-mailed to you. If you need to see them again, you can view them at any time from your AWS account.

To view your AWS access identifiers

  1. Log in to the AWS security credentials web site.

  2. Scroll down to the Access Credentials section and select the Access Keys tab.

  3. Locate an active Access Key in the Your Access Keys list.

  4. To display the Secret Access Key, click Show in the Secret Access Key column.
